8. Update on the End Zone Property <br /> In mid-July 2006, City staff inspected the End Zone restaurant and motel and observed a <br /> condition of slum and blight, including the open doors at the motel revealing refuse, <br /> debris, and junk. City staff sent property owner Alex and Zena Minich a certified letter <br /> requesting that the property be cleaned up and secured by Friday, July 28, 2006. Alex <br /> and Len Minich met with City staff on Friday, July 28, 2006, at City Hall, and discussed <br /> the issue and staff provided them a demolition application. To date,the Minich's have <br /> not done anything to clean up or secure the motel buildings. Under Minnesota Statute, <br /> the City's chief building official has the jurisdiction under which to request the <br /> immediate removal of a public health, safety hazard, of which staff has determined that <br /> this property has presented itself as. Alex and Len Minich were present at the August 7, <br /> 2006 City Council meeting stating that they had filed for a demolition permit with the <br /> City for the two motel buildings and the house. The bar/restaurant building will remain. <br /> Staff has attached the letters sent to the Minich's including the letter stating they have 30 <br /> days to remove the buildings. <br />
